What "Modern" Actually Means (Hint: It’s Not Weird Spellings)

Here’s where many parents mess up.

Modern does not mean inventing a name no one can pronounce. It also doesn’t mean copying a celebrity baby name just because it sounds cool.

In real life, modern names usually:

  • Are short
  • Sound soft
  • Have a clear meaning
  • Work in school, office, and family settings

Think of it like clothes. Trendy outfits look great once. Classic styles last years. Names work the same way.

Keep the Name Easy to Live With

This is where many names fail.

If a name needs constant spelling or pronunciation help, it becomes annoying fast. Cute at birth. Frustrating at school.

Ask yourself:

  • Can teachers say it easily?
  • Will she have to correct people every time?

Simple names age better. Always.

Tradition + Modern = Best Combo

This balance usually wins.

Take a traditional root. Give it a modern sound.

Examples:

  • Sita → Sia
  • Radha → Riya
  • Lakshmi → Laksha

This keeps elders happy and still feels fresh.

Real Examples Parents Actually Like Today

Here are names that genuinely work well:

  • Mira – Peace, ocean
  • Anya – Grace
  • Zara – Blooming flower
  • Ira – Earth, goddess Saraswati
  • Nysa – New beginning

Notice the pattern? Short. Soft. Meaningful.

FAQs

What makes a baby girl name modern?

Short length, easy sound, and relevance today.

Is meaning really important?

Yes. Sound fades. Meaning lasts.

Are modern names accepted by elders?

Usually yes, if roots are clear.

Can spelling make a name modern?

A little, yes. Too much? No.

How many names should I shortlist?

Three to five. More creates confusion.
